There's No Place Like Home
Home is home even if you are leasing it. And whether it's a townhome or a condo, protection for your personal belongings is a wise idea, whether or not your landlord requires it.

Renters rarely realize how much money they have tied up in their possessions. Just because you are renting a property or apartment, you still own plenty of property and personal items—such as a smartphone, laptop, set of favorite books, and more. All of these have value, which would be a real loss if damaged or destroyed. That's why you need renters insurance from State Farm. Why buy your renters insurance from Paul Kruse?
